Deadpool Pulp #4
In "Untitled," Deadpool’s fractured past unravels as he confronts a shocking truth: his years of torment in a Japanese POW camp were a lie, replaced by a far more insidious captivity in Cuba at the hands of Stryfe. Written by Adam Glass and Mike Benson, with art by Laurence Campbell and colors by Lee Loughridge, the story dives into Wade’s psyche as his inner voices battle Stryfe’s programming. When he reunites with Outlaw, the stakes spike—she’s stolen a nuclear briefcase, and her true intentions are far from what he believed. The cover by Jae Lee captures the tension in stark, striking detail.
